Output 7568e021a415c1a36666900d4d7932868b3ff4098116b57c0e666af7a04cb826:1

value
12620900
script pubkey
OP_0 OP_PUSHBYTES_20 29f4f05bf7f40b9bf6b3a13cd485892300998cb1
address
bc1q9860qklh7s9eha4n5y7dfpvfyvqfnr935wf4l8
transaction
7568e021a415c1a36666900d4d7932868b3ff4098116b57c0e666af7a04cb826
confirmations
98803
spent
true